欧几里得辗转相除算法的递归写法

来源:互联网 发布:怎么自学计算机编程 编辑:程序博客网 时间:2024/05/13 10:33
在看《数论》是看到欧几里得算法可以这样写,脑洞大开。

 欧几里得辗转相除用于求两数的最大公约数

1 int Gcd(int a,int b)2 {3    if(b==0) 4     return a;//出口5    return Gcd(b,a%b);6 7 }

 

0 0
原创粉丝点击